Masterclass Certificate in Cultivating Mindfulness during Cancer Treatment is increasingly significant in today's UK healthcare market. Cancer diagnoses are sadly prevalent; according to Cancer Research UK, over 400,000 people are diagnosed annually. This high incidence highlights a growing need for effective coping mechanisms, with mindfulness emerging as a key tool for managing stress and anxiety associated with cancer and its treatments. The demand for professionals skilled in integrating mindfulness into cancer care is therefore escalating, reflected in increased job opportunities for oncology nurses, psycho-oncologists, and support workers trained in mindfulness techniques. A Masterclass Certificate provides the necessary credentials to meet this expanding demand.

Cancer Type Approximate Annual Diagnoses (Thousands)
Breast 55
Lung 48
Prostate 47
Bowel 44
Other 206
